Under the new rules of democracy in the UK ( the definition has been changed during the last 2 years ) the ERG is calling for a re-run of the no confidence vote because Mp's did not understand what they were voting for, and the 'remain with Theresa' party overspent on their campaign. Theresa May did survive but with only around 40 votes in it ( less than 15% of Conservative MP's) she is badly damaged. To achieve that small majority she had to promise not to lead the party into the next election (after her 'one man' handling of the 2017 election where she composed the party manifesto on her own and non of the cabinet was allowed to see it until it was too late to change it - there is a pattern emerging here).
